Innovation is the foundation of Sweden's development, for the future society and the competitiveness we want and need. Early results from the Impact Innovation innovation initiative shows how the five programs are now well on their way to both creating groundbreaking innovations and conditions for society to receive them.
At the seminar, program managers for Net Zero Industry, ShiftSweden, SustainGov, Swedish Metals and Minerals and Water Wise Societies discuss the strengths and weaknesses of this unique effort that leads the way and shows the way – how they work to enable an inclusive societal transformation and a sustainable and competitive Sverige?
